Which country was the first in the world to set up a statutory body for environmental protection?

AIndia

BAustralia

CNew Zealand

DUnited States

Answer:

B. Australia

Read Explanation:

  • Australia was the first country in the world to establish a statutory body specifically dedicated to environmental protection. 
  • India is the third country in the world, after Australia and New Zealand, to set up a statutory body for environmental protection (The National Green Tribunal (NGT)

The National Green Tribunal (NGT)

  • It is a specialized body established in 2010 under the National Green Tribunal Act.
  • Its primary objective is to handle cases related to environmental protection, conservation of natural resources, and the implementation of laws aimed at protecting the environment.
  • The NGT is responsible for the effective and expeditious disposal of cases within a specified timeframe, ensuring that environmental disputes are resolved promptly.
